Had the chance to chrono factory 80 ELD-VT last week out of the 16” barrel. 10 shots averaged 2735 fps.

The 108s averaged 2487 the same day.

Taking the chrono values from the last two range sessions and comparing them to Hornady box values, this 16 inch barrel is shooting just under 91% of the box speed. I’d expect to get around 2700 fps from the factory 90 cx.

A Tikka is not available in 6CM or 6ARC? It can be done, but there is no easy button. The 243 is available.

The two rifles I use the most are a 223 Tikka and a 6 ARC Howa. The Tikka action is slicker than the Howa's, but not enough that I worry about it. My Howa is at least as accurate as the Tikka. The Howa has a better stock. With the same stock, the Tikka might surpass it.
